What makes Anne Rice's romance novels unique?

3 answers
2024-11-12 17:54

Her use of the supernatural. In her novels, like 'The Vampire Chronicles', she combines the allure of vampires with romance. This makes for a very different kind of love story compared to traditional romance novels.

What makes 'The Queen of the Damned' stand out among Anne Rice's romance novels?

1 answer
2024-11-30 17:08

The exploration of dark themes. Anne Rice doesn't shy away from exploring themes like death, immortality, and the consequences of power. These themes are intertwined with the romance in the story, making it more than just a simple love story. It challenges the readers to think about deeper concepts while still enjoying the romantic aspects.
